About the role

Balfour Beatty is seeking a Safety Health & Environmental Manager to join our team at a state-of-the-art operations facility consisting of a multi-story building that will include open office areas, collaborative multi-discipline workspace, computer labs, and virtual instruction/distance learning-enabled classrooms, along with an accompanying parking garage. This project is design-build. This position is responsible for the implementation of the company’s safety and loss prevention programs. In addition, this role ensures job-site employees and subcontractors are trained in all safety programs and protocol, including federal/state regulations, in order to prevent accidents and/or injuries. This position may involve traveling between different jobsites or being assigned to one project.

Responsibilities

  • Coordinate and facilitate safety training and incentive programs, maintain statistical information on costs and frequency, perform accident investigations, manage safety personnel and consultants, including, but not limited to, the following specific tasks:
    • Jobsite visits/safety audits – frequency as dictated by project and/or project personnel
    • Project safety start-up packets – new-hire packets, federal/state compliance materials, safety and workers compensation material
    • Review/assist superintendents with project-specific safety plans, Pre-Task Plans (PTPs), Job Hazard Analyses (JHAs), Activity Hazard Analyses (AHAs), and other safety submittals
    • Provide support to project team and subcontractors in meetings such as daily huddles, foreman’s meetings, and preparatory meetings
    • SDS books – Provide sources for projects to obtain, ensure that projects have required information on-site
    • Accident investigations, including written reports
    • Addresses and provides resources and solutions for environmental and hazardous material issues and concerns
    • Safety training and tracking of said training for project personnel
    • First aid training to ensure supervisors have required up-to-date first aid cards
    • Keeper of the site safety records
    • Oversees the site’s craft/hourly drug testing program
    • Represents the Company at meetings of safety professionals, alliances, associations, etc.
